Pricing
Mutual LDS Dating operates on a freemium model. The basic features are available for free, allowing users to create profiles, browse, and message other users. However, for those looking to enhance their experience, there are premium subscription options. These subscriptions unlock additional features like seeing who viewed your profile and sending unlimited messages, which can be beneficial for users serious about finding a match.

Mutual is great app for meeting people initially. If you are only using the free version, Mutual slows its frequency showing your profile over time. Mutual's free version also only lets you match with people who have liked you ONLY IF they happen to pop up on your feed. I personally have much more success on the free version of Hinge because they make the likes far more accessible.
